What is compelling evidence used in critical thinking and the court of law?

1 Answer

6 votes
The compelling evidence used in critical thinking and the court of law is proof. A proof is an evidence that verifies all the conclusions and facts that were stated by a party. It supports to establish the truth of a statement. It is also a strong type of evidence that is directly confirming the truth.
